What is the importance of pivot table?

The importance of Pivot Tables lies in their ability to simplify and analyze large datasets, making it easier for users to identify trends, patterns, or relationships within the data. Pivot Tables enable efficient and effective decision-making by providing a concise summary of key insights without having to manually sort through extensive amounts of raw data.
